Vangie is a girl's name with 2 syllables. In 1987 it was given to 5 babies in the United States.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.
- Peaked in 1955, when 19 babies were given the name.
- It has largely dropped out of use.
- First appears in US birth records in 1896.
- 2 syllables, with the stress on syllable 1.
Vangie over time
Births per decade in the United States, 1890s to 1980s. The striped bar is the 1980s, still in progress — it covers 1980 to 1987, not a full ten years.
Show the numbers
| Decade | Births |
|---|---|
| 1890s | 5 |
| 1900s | 7 |
| 1910s | 15 |
| 1920s | 55 |
| 1930s | 60 |
| 1940s | 102 |
| 1950s | 167 |
| 1960s | 137 |
| 1970s | 90 |
| 1980s (to 1987) | 15 |
